On 19/12/16 00:25, Andrey Smirnov wrote:
Driver code never touches "rstn" signal in atomic context, so there's
no need to implicitly put such restriction on it by using gpio_set_value
to manipulate it. Replace gpio_set_value to gpio_set_value_cansleep to
fix that.
We need to make sure we are not assuming it can be called in such a
context in the future now. But that is something we can worry about if
it comes up.
As a an example of where such restriction might be inconvenient,
consider a hardware design where "rstn" is connected to a pin of I2C/SPI
GPIO expander chip.
